Apple Adds Smart Display Zoom in iOS 26 to Optimize CarPlay for More Vehicle Displays

Summary

  • Smart Display Zoom in iOS 26 automatically adjusts CarPlay to a vehicle’s screen, a new Display setting inside the CarPlay Settings app.
  • Different infotainment screens vary widely in size and shape, and the feature is designed to adapt CarPlay’s layout to those display differences.
  • Hands-on use showed some apps, including Apple Podcasts, can display more content when the setting is enabled, though changes are not dramatic in every interface.
  • The feature joins a broader set of CarPlay additions in iOS 26, with Apple having expanded that list further in the iOS 26.4 update.
